I am excited that I can finally eat again. My doc was worried that I wouldn't be able to stay on a liquid diet until the 21st so he called Sat. morning. He asked me how I was doing and I said that I was starving. He said he wanted to see what I could eat to determine when I should come in. So he put me on mushies all day Saturday and told me that if I didn't have any pain that I could go to soft Proteins on Sunday and then to call him back last night. So that is what I did and it was so nice to be able to eat again. Since I was able to get over easy eggs, some tuna fish, and a piece of salmon down he said that I could wait until the 21st to come in. Otherwise he wanted me in today. He said that if the fill continues to feel like it is loosening that I could cancel my unfill appt. He told me to leave my next fill scheduled for the 26th of March and to just keep pushing it back unless I felt zero restriction. He said with my determination and change in lifestyle he felt that I could be with lesser restriction than some and still be successful. He said with me being so far away from the office (5+ hours) that he didn't want me being very tight if I could handle it. Well I will tell you this, I would rather have less restriction and have to handle some of the hunger than be so tight that I have to stay on liquids! Wow, all of you are doing great (and including myself). I do get discouraged too trying to figure out what to do to lose more steadily. So far it seems my pattern is to lose 5-6 lbs in a 2 week period then hold steady for 2-3 weeks or more. I up my calories to 1500 per a different dietician who said I wasn't eating enough......that didn't work. I bought it back down to 800....didn't work. Last week I added an additional 10 minutes to my walk and increased the pace......didn't work. As far as eating, I can only drink upon awaking up until about 11 a.m. Then I'll eat my lunch. Also I still get hungry every 2-3 hours (but yet I think I do have restricition). Since last fill, can't eat grits, eggs or bread (maybe 1 slice of wheat toast or about 6 whole grain soda crackers). I can hold about 2 cups of food versus the 1 that I should. Do I really have restriction? Maybe not but definely different. Oh, I've now gone about a week w/o PB'ng as I never knew eating the same thing the next day would come back up or not. At one point for about 2 weeks after last fill, I was PB'g everyday in the mornings. Anyway, again you all are doing fantastic and I still think my 46 lb weight loss is great.
